#e24986 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#e24986 is composed of 88.6% red, 28.6% green and 52.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 67.7% magenta, 40.7% yellow and 11.4% black. It has a hue angle of 336.1 degrees, a saturation of 72.5% and a lightness of 58.6%. #e24986 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ff92ff with #c5000d. Closest websafe color is: #cc3399.

Shades and Tints of #e24986

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#040102 is the darkest color, while #fdf2f6 is the lightest one.

Tones of #e24986

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#999295 is the less saturated color, while #fa3181 is the most saturated one.
